摘要: 洛谷:P2831 愤怒的小鸟 题目传送门 本题是一道很明显的状压DP,麻烦的是浮点数的处理和抛物线的计算,这里讲一些注意事项: 一.浮点数判相等: 二.抛物线的判断: 题目中的抛物线有两个未知数,在正常情况下,每两点便可确定一条抛物线,但以下情况除外: 1.两点所在的直线经过原点 2.两点横坐标相等 阅读全文
posted @ 2020-10-12 22:46 岚默笙 阅读(259) 评论(0) 推荐(0) 编辑
摘要: 浅谈状压DP 状压DP,是指通过一个01串来记录转移的状态,再通过DP的思想转移方程。 例:如共有五个节点,当前选择了第1、2、3号节点,则状态为 (00111)2 = (7) 10 由于计算机中的存储都采用二进制,我们可以通过位运算很方便的进行状态转移 注意:状压DP一般数据范围较小,多通过位运算 阅读全文
posted @ 2020-10-12 22:32 岚默笙 阅读(188) 评论(0) 推荐(0) 编辑